Two Tickets to Paris starring Joey Dee, Gary Crosby, Kay Medford, Jeri Lynn Frazer has a NR rating, a runtime of about 1 hr 30 min, and a scheduled release date of November 28th, 1962.

It received a user score of 40/100 on TMDb, which compiled reviews from 1 respected users.

Wondering what this story is all about? Here's the plot: "In this musical, fairly light movie, two young people, Joey and Piper are in love. They embark on a cruise to Paris to get married, with the acerbic but kind Aggie as a chaperon. Along the way, their sweet innocent romance runs into trouble when Coco, a french dancer uses Joey to make her straying boyfriend jealous." .
